Abstract

The weight sensor circuit has a square wave generator which supplies a sawtooth generator whose output is limited. A power circuit is used to drive the weight sensors. The sawtooth generator also drives a threshold circuit whose valve is compared with a reference voltage. The threshold circuit output controls analogue gating circuits. The power circuit is also connected via an impedance matching circuit and gate to a memory whose output is proportional to the speed of the conveyor. A comparator connected to the memory output controls the square wave generator. The sensor output is connected via an impedance matching circuit and gate to a memory to provide a dc output signal proportional to speed and weight of material flow. The arrangement avoids complex transformation and rectification of an AC signal.
